Article Summary
TrojAI announced the launch of TrojAI Defend for Model Context Protocol (MCP), a security solution aimed at safeguarding agentic AI workflows.
- Defend for MCP creates a robust security layer, inspecting data exchanged between large language models (LLMs) and the external tools they utilize through the MCP standard.
- The product acts as an intermediary, preventing malicious outputs from tools and ensuring that LLMs receive clean, secure data.
- It specifically targets critical threats such as prompt injection, data exfiltration, and supply chain attacks that can exploit vulnerabilities in agentic tool interactions.
- MCP is described as an open standard enabling secure and reliable interaction between LLMs and external tools, APIs, and databases, crucial for autonomous AI agent operations.
